Trinity Grass in the Apennines
Did you know that ...
In the Middle Ages, the lilac-colored trinity herb was used for therapeutic purposes against liver diseases, because at that time there was a widespread belief that anything in nature that resembled a part of the human body, in shape or color, was therapeutic for remedying ailments of that part of the body.
A mistaken belief as this plant has no healing properties and, on the contrary, it appears to be slightly toxic.
